Editorial Reviews

This 1958 session by the Wynton Kelly Trio (aka the Miles Davis rhythm section) with special guests Kenny Burrell on guitar, captures fully the joy and blues feeling of Kelly at his best.

Before his untimely death, Wynton Kelly was one of the jazz world's great pianists---tasteful, swinging, bluesy, a little block chording, a little modal. Best known for his accompaniment in groups led by the likes of Miles Davis, Kelly was outstanding in his own right. This session, his first as a leader, was recorded before he joined Davis. He is joined by two soon-to-be mainstays in the Davis group (Paul Chambers, Philly Joe Jones) and Kenny Burrell on guitar. Classic performances on '50s favorites such as "Ill Wind", the minor "Whisper Not" and "Don't Explain".

I first heard Kelly's unique style on 'Freddy Freeloader' on Miles Davis' 'Kind of Blue' classic. Here he teams with 'Blue' alum Paul Chambers on bass,Davis regular Philly Joe Jones on drums-and the great Kenny Burrell on guitar.Regardless of tempo,this is flawless-and well worth the price for its two takes of 'Dark Eyes',alone.
